In a significant political move, Governor Abdullahi Sule of Nasarawa State has clinched the All Progressives Congress (APC) senatorial ticket for the Nasarawa North Senatorial District, setting the stage for a competitive 2027 election. This victory not only solidifies Sule's political standing but also reflects the APC's strategic positioning in a region crucial for national politics.
Sule's success comes amid a backdrop of intense party rivalry and shifting voter sentiments. As he prepares for the upcoming electoral battle, stakeholders within the APC express confidence in his leadership. “Governor Sule has consistently demonstrated his commitment to the people of Nasarawa. His ticket is an affirmation of our party’s vision for the future,” stated Ahmed Aliyu, a prominent APC member.
Looking ahead, Sule's senatorial candidacy could galvanize support for the APC, especially as the party seeks to maintain its influence in the region. With the election drawing near, his ability to unify party factions and address local concerns will be critical in determining not only his fate but also the APC's prospects in Nasarawa and beyond.
